Discretion to make or vary bail decision without bail application53 Discretion to make or vary bail decision without bail application
(1) A court or authorised justice with power to hear a bail application may, of its own motion, on a first appearance by an accused person for an offence--(a) grant bail to the person (with or without the imposition of bail conditions), or(b) vary a previous bail decision made for the offence (but not so as to refuse bail).
(2) A court or authorised justice may exercise a power under this section only to benefit the accused person.
(3) This section does not limit the powers of a court when a bail application is made.
(4) This section does not permit the grant of bail, without a bail application, for a show cause offence.
